Discover data in Asset Management


Discovery applications discover CI data and store the data in an internal database, which can then be populated into BMC Helix CMDB. These applications discover data on a regular basis such as when new hardware or software is installed or uninstalled and as updates happen in the company's environment. You must set up the required filters at the discovery level itself so that only necessary data is populated in the CMDB when data is discovered.

Discovery products automate the process of populating BMC Helix CMDB. When these products discover IT hardware and software, they create CIs and relationships from the discovered data.

For example, you might use BMC Client Management or BMC Helix Discovery to populate BMC Helix CMDB. BMC Configuration Automation for Clients can discover CI types such as computer system, processor, operating system, and software product. BMC Atrium Discovery can discover CI types, such as computer system, cluster, application, and business service.
